Overview: With the production of the Informer 80-80, IRI needed a mech designed specifically to protect their dedicated HPG carrier. 8 BILLION C-Bills as a price tag for the Informer meant that whatever the escort was, it must be top-of-the-line, and cost would be no issue. A Clan RAC/2 and twin Clan Large Pulse Lasers provide the main punch against hostile forces, while twin Small Pulse Lasers and three Micro Pulse Lasers will carve up enemy infantry with ease. Capable of moving at 86.4kph, the Guardian Angel also features heavily slabbed on Ferro-Fibrous armor, giving it a good combat endurance. Even with the Guardian Angel's excellent base of weaponry, IRI felt the need for something heavier, for a last resort in case the Guardian Angel's were destroyed. This effort led to the Balaur Assault Quad.

Overview: Designed as the last resort for protecting the Informer 80-80, the Balaur is a nightmare of a quad. Physically resembling a massive version of the Boggart, the Balaur is sheathed in 34 tons of Imperius Rex Protection Systems Hardened Armor, making it an absolute pain to destroy. A Clan RAC/2 provides long range reach, while intermediate ranges are covered by a terrifying Improved Heavy Laser mounted in a turret. Twin Micro Pulse Lasers on each front leg discourage infantry attack, and twin center torso Medium Pulse Lasers provide an accurate punch versus all hostiles. All weapons are guided by a Clan-Spec Targeting Computer, and the Balaur makes use of a standard fusion reactor to provide even more durability. 17 Double Heat Sinks keep the mech chilled, and Clan CASE prevents crippling explosions.
